Do Explore Different Tailgate Locations

Arrowhead Stadium has various tailgate locations within the stadium complex that offer unique experiences. Check out the Tee Pee group in Lot C or the campers in Lot N for a different tailgating atmosphere. Exploring different areas allows you to mingle with different groups of fans and experience the diverse tailgate setups. Each location has its own charm, and you may discover a new favorite spot for future games.

Arrowhead Stadium Tailgate Parking Guidelines

Parking at Arrowhead Stadium follows certain rules and regulations to ensure a safe and organized environment for all guests. Here are the tailgate parking guidelines and policies to keep in mind:

  1. One vehicle per parking space: Each parking space is designated for one vehicle. Be mindful of the space, allowing enough room for other tailgaters.
  2. Parking lot opening hours: Parking lots open 4.5 hours prior to kickoff. Arriving early ensures ample time to set up your tailgate party.
  3. Ticketed event guests only: Access to the Truman Sports Complex, including the parking lots, is restricted to those with event tickets. Make sure to have your tickets ready for entry.
  4. Prohibited signs and displays: Offensive signs and displays, including the Confederate Flag, are not allowed within the premises. Please respect the guidelines to maintain a friendly and inclusive atmosphere.
  5. Oversized vehicle parking: If you have a bus or RV, there are specific parking areas designated for oversized vehicles. Follow the instructions provided by the parking attendants.
  6. Rideshare services: Uber and Lyft have designated drop-off and pick-up points within the stadium complex. Check the official Arrowhead Stadium website for the exact locations.
  7. Electric car parking: Electric car owners can take advantage of the parking spots with charging stations, available on a first-come, first-served basis. Arrive early to secure a spot if you require charging for your vehicle.
  8. Additional assistance options: Arrowhead Stadium provides mobility carts and fan assistance booths in the parking lots to accommodate guests who require extra support. Feel free to utilize these services if needed.

Adhering to the tailgate parking guidelines and policies ensures a smooth and enjoyable experience for everyone. Violations of the rules may result in ejection or the loss of privileges. For a complete list of parking terms and conditions, please visit the official Arrowhead Stadium website.

Getting to Arrowhead Stadium

Arrowhead Stadium, home to the Kansas City Chiefs, is conveniently located at the Truman Sports Complex in Kansas City. Whether you’re a local resident or visiting from out of town, here are some tips on how to easily navigate your way to the stadium.

Directions by Car

If you’re traveling by car, Arrowhead Stadium is easily accessible from major highways in the area. Use the following directions to reach the stadium:

  1. From the north: Take I-435 south and exit onto Stadium Drive. Follow the signs for Arrowhead Stadium.
  2. From the south: Take US-71 north and exit onto I-435 east. Continue on I-435 east and take the exit for Stadium Drive.
  3. From the east: Take I-70 west and exit onto I-435 south. Exit onto Stadium Drive and follow the signs for Arrowhead Stadium.
  4. From the west: Take I-70 east and exit onto I-435 south. Continue on I-435 south and take the exit for Stadium Drive.

It’s always a good idea to plan your route in advance and check for any traffic updates to ensure a smooth journey to the stadium. Navigation apps like Google Maps can provide real-time directions based on current traffic conditions.

Parking and Entrance Gates

Arrowhead Stadium offers several parking options for guests. Once you arrive at the stadium, follow the signs to the designated parking lots. Here is a breakdown of the parking lots and their corresponding entrance gates:

Parking Lot Entrance Gate
Lot A Gate 1
Lot B Gate 2
Lot C Gates 3-6
Lot D Gates 7-9
Lot E Gate 3

Make sure to remember your parking lot and entrance gate to easily locate your vehicle after the game.

For a more detailed parking lot map, you can visit the official Arrowhead Stadium website. The map will help you visualize the different parking sections and plan your game day logistics accordingly.
